There are over 130 mountain bike trails around Le Pout, offering a wide variety of options for riders of all skill levels. The region is well-equipped for mountain biking enthusiasts, with routes traversing diverse landscapes.
The majority of mountain bike trails in Le Pout are considered easy or moderate. Specifically, there are 78 easy routes and 54 moderate routes. There is also one difficult trail for experienced riders seeking a challenge.
The mountain bike trails around Le Pout are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.3 stars from over 230 reviews. Riders often praise the varied terrain, winding singletracks, and the mix of forest and open meadow sections.
Yes, Le Pout offers many easy mountain bike trails per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ed ride. An excellent option is the Sadirac ludique – Roger Lapébie trail loop from Créon, which is 11.4 km long and features minimal elevation gain.

Many of the mountain bike routes in Le Pout are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the Sheep Meadows – Forest trail loop from Créon is an easy 19.2 km circular route that takes you through pleasant forest and meadow sections.

Yes, there are several points of interest you might encounter. The Roger Lapébie Cycle Path: Créon to Dardenac is a notable feature, and you might also pass through the Espiet tunnel. These offer interesting diversions during your ride.
Yes, you can find places to stop for refreshments. For instance, the Bistrot de la Pimpine is a highlight located near some of the trails, offering a convenient spot to refuel during your ride.
Many of the easy and moderate trails in Le Pout are suitable for families. Routes that feature established paths and lower elevation gains, such as the Sadirac ludique – Roger Lapébie trail loop from Créon, are great choices for a family outing on mountain bikes.
